Thomas and Margaret Henderson were Irish convicts who arrived in Sydney in 1793. Their background in Ireland has not yet been discovered. Their only son, Robert Henderson, is the path to the next generation in this family tree.

Note: The document '1834-henderson-john-marriage.jpg' is provided to disprove a theory promulgated by some researchers that the John Henderson who married Ruth Hill in 1834 was the son of Thomas and Margaret Henderson. This document shows that the John Henderson in question was a convict who arrived 25 years after Thomas and Margaret and 15 years after Margaret died. I have found no information to suggest that Thomas and Margaret ever had a son named John and I suspect that Robert may have been an only child.
